- A bird has a nest, man has a home.
(Tywa Proverb)
- A good person has many friends, a good horse has many masters.
(Tywa Proverb)
- A herdsman needs a staff, a door needs a bolt.
(Tywa Proverb)
- A spoken word, carved wood.
(Tywa Proverb)
- Even though he misses his duck, he will not miss his lake.
(Tywa Proverb)
- Even though his stomach is satiated, his eye will not be satiated.
(Tywa Proverb)
- Even though it is black, the raven loves its young.
(Tywa Proverb)

- Man grows up, felt wears out.
(Tywa Proverb)
- Nutcrackers crack cedar seeds, monks crack rosary beads.
(Tywa Proverb)
